문서를 영문으로 보려면 영문 확인란을 선택하세요. 마우스 포인터를 텍스트 위로 이동시켜 팝업 창에서 영문 텍스트를 표시할 수도 있습니다.
번역
영문

SQL Server 테이블에 열 추가

SQL Server Native Client OLE DB 공급자는 ITableDefinition::AddColumn 함수를 표시하므로 소비자가 SQL Server 테이블에 열을 추가할 수 있습니다.

SQL Server 테이블에 열을 추가하는 경우 SQL Server Native Client OLE DB 공급자 소비자는 다음과 같이 제한됩니다.

  • DBPROP_COL_AUTOINCREMENT가 VARIANT_TRUE이면 DBPROP_COL_NULLABLE은 VARIANT_FALSE여야 합니다.

  • SQL Server timestamp 데이터 형식을 사용하여 열을 정의하는 경우 DBPROP_COL_NULLABLE은 VARIANT_FALSE여야 합니다.

  • 다른 모든 열 정의에서 DBPROP_COL_NULLABLE은 VARIANT_TRUE여야 합니다.

소비자는 pTableID 매개 변수에서 uName 공용 구조체의 pwszName 멤버에 테이블 이름을 유니코드 문자열로 지정합니다. pTableIDeKind 멤버는 DBKIND_NAME이어야 합니다.

새로운 열 이름은 DBCOLUMNDESC 매개 변수 pColumnDescdbcid 멤버에 있는 uName 공용 구조체의 pwszName 멤버에서 유니코드 문자열로 지정됩니다. eKind 멤버는 DBKIND_NAME이어야 합니다.

커뮤니티 추가 항목

추가
표시: